Author: qwiat
Date: Wed Oct 11 01:31:22 2006
New Revision: 7844
Modified:
PLD-doc/book/pl_book__uslugi/pl_uslugi__apache.sec
Log:
- przepisanie sekcji o indeksach
Modified: PLD-doc/book/pl_book__uslugi/pl_uslugi__apache.sec
==============================================================================
--- PLD-doc/book/pl_book__uslugi/pl_uslugi__apache.sec (original)
+++ PLD-doc/book/pl_book__uslugi/pl_uslugi__apache.sec Wed Oct 11 01:31:22 2006
@@ -548,25 +548,33 @@
<option>DocumentRoot</option> ustawioną na
<filename
class="directory">/home/services/httpd/html/mail</filename>.</para>
</section>
+
+
<section id="uslugi_apache_index">
<title>Indeksowana zawartość katalogu</title>
- <para>Jest to bardzo przydatna funkcja w Apache. Jeżeli chcemy
komuś udostępniać
- pliki znajdujące się w jakimś katalogu strony na
serwerze możemy ją dotego
- wykorzystać. Przykładową konfigurację możesz obejrzeć
na zamieszczonym
- poniżej przykładzie.</para>
- <screen><Directory "/home/users/jan/public_html/pliki">
- Options Indexes FollowSymLinks MultiViews
- AllowOverride None
- Order allow,deny
- Allow from all
+ <para>
+ Jest to bardzo przydatna funkcja, pozwalająca w łatwy
+ sposób udostępnić zawartość katalogu na serwerze. Aby
+ umożliwić indeksowanie musimy zainstalować moduł
+ <literal>apache-mod_autoindex</literal>.
+ </para>
+ <para>
+ <screen>poldek -i apache-mod_autoindex</screen>
+ Aby uruchomić indeksy musimy włączyć opcję
<option>Indexes</option>.
+ W domyślnej konfiguracji, Apache ma włączone indeksy
+ dla wszystkich podkatalogów wewnątrz
/home/services/httpd/html
+ (w pliku <filename>10_common.conf</filename>). Jeśli
+ ustawiliśmy inaczej to musimy włączać tą opcję dla
+ każdego z katalogów osobno np.:
+<screen><Directory /home/services/httpd/html/katalog>
+ Options Indexes
</Directory></screen>
- <para>Opcją odpowiadającą za wyświetlenie plików jest tutaj
<option>Indexes</option>.
- Zadziała ona tylko wtedy, kiedy w obszarze jej działania nie
znajdzie się żaden
- plik określony przez <option>DirectoryIndex</option>.</para>
- <para>Indeksowanie katalogu wymaga obecności modułów mod_autoindex oraz
mod_dir. Są one
- dostępne w zasobach dystrybucji:
- <screen># poldek -i apache-mod_dir
apache-mod_autoindex</screen></para>
-</section>
+ Opcja nie zadziała wtedy, kiedy zainstalowaliśmy moduł
+ <literal>apache-mod_dir</literal> i w katalogu znajduje
się plik
+ określony przez <option>DirectoryIndex</option>.
+ </para>
+ </section>
+
<section id="uslugi_apache_deny">
<title>Ograniczanie dostępu do serwera</title>
<para>Być może spotkasz się z problemem kiedy na Twoim serwerze
znajdować się będzie kilka
_______________________________________________
pld-cvs-commit mailing list
[email protected]
http://lists.pld-linux.org/mailman/listinfo/pld-cvs-commit